Question
the table shows the time a patient spends at the dentist and the amount of the bill. what is the correlation coefficient for the data in the table? -0.93 -0.27 0.27 0.93
Step1: Calculate the means
Let \(x\) be the time spent at the dentist and \(y\) be the bill amount.
\(\bar{x}=\frac{1.4 + 2.7+0.75 + 1.6}{4}=\frac{6.45}{4}=1.6125\)
\(\bar{y}=\frac{235+867 + 156+215}{4}=\frac{1473}{4}=368.25\)
Step2: Calculate numerator and denominator
Numerator: \(\sum_{i = 1}^{4}(x_{i}-\bar{x})(y_{i}-\bar{y})\)
\((1.4 - 1.6125)(235 - 368.25)+(2.7-1.6125)(867 - 368.25)+(0.75 - 1.6125)(156 - 368.25)+(1.6 - 1.6125)(215 - 368.25)\)
\(=(- 0.2125)(-133.25)+(1.0875)(498.75)+(-0.8625)(-212.25)+(-0.0125)(-153.25)\)
\(=28.315625+542.578125 + 183.046875+1.915625=755.85625\)
Denominator: \(\sqrt{\sum_{i = 1}^{4}(x_{i}-\bar{x})^{2}\sum_{i = 1}^{4}(y_{i}-\bar{y})^{2}}\)
\(\sum_{i = 1}^{4}(x_{i}-\bar{x})^{2}=(1.4 - 1.6125)^{2}+(2.7-1.6125)^{2}+(0.75 - 1.6125)^{2}+(1.6 - 1.6125)^{2}\)
\(=(-0.2125)^{2}+(1.0875)^{2}+(-0.8625)^{2}+(-0.0125)^{2}\)
\(=0.04515625+1.18265625+0.74390625 + 0.00015625=1.971875\)
\(\sum_{i = 1}^{4}(y_{i}-\bar{y})^{2}=(235 - 368.25)^{2}+(867 - 368.25)^{2}+(156 - 368.25)^{2}+(215 - 368.25)^{2}\)
\(=(-133.25)^{2}+(498.75)^{2}+(-212.25)^{2}+(-153.25)^{2}\)
\(=17755.5625+248751.5625+45050.0625+23485.5625=335042.75\)
\(\sqrt{1.971875\times335042.75}=\sqrt{660625.390625}=812.8\)
Step3: Calculate correlation coefficient
\(r=\frac{755.85625}{812.8}\approx0.93\)
